Output e6cda6e5401ebf46a22ab2c9af40d6698cce5e40a39a05e22c4944189667b269:120

value
523812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5c5a363061af7d24c1aa3a17636158dd2be2fd OP_EQUAL
address
3L9143rU8kSWRzJNGuojZB5CCPCCTEKdSM
transaction
e6cda6e5401ebf46a22ab2c9af40d6698cce5e40a39a05e22c4944189667b269
confirmations
357538
spent
true